Searched refs:assign_p (Results 1 – 5 of 5) sorted by relevance
/illumos-gate/usr/src/uts/sun4/io/px/ |
H A D | px_util.c | 145 pci_regspec_t *assign_p; in px_reloc_reg() local 170 "assigned-addresses", (caddr_t)&assign_p, &assign_len); in px_reloc_reg() 179 for (i = 0; i < assign_entries; i++, assign_p++) { in px_reloc_reg() 180 uint32_t assign_type = assign_p->pci_phys_hi & PCI_REG_ADDR_M; in px_reloc_reg() 181 uint32_t assign_addr = PCI_REG_BDFR_G(assign_p->pci_phys_hi); in px_reloc_reg() 186 rp->pci_phys_low += assign_p->pci_phys_low; in px_reloc_reg() 188 rp->pci_phys_mid += assign_p->pci_phys_mid; in px_reloc_reg() 193 rp->pci_phys_low += assign_p->pci_phys_low; in px_reloc_reg() 198 kmem_free(assign_p - i, assign_len); in px_reloc_reg()
|
/illumos-gate/usr/src/uts/sun4u/io/pci/ |
H A D | pci_util.c | 160 pci_regspec_t *assign_p; in pci_reloc_reg() local 178 "assigned-addresses", (caddr_t)&assign_p, &assign_len)) in pci_reloc_reg() 182 for (i = 0; i < assign_entries; i++, assign_p++) { in pci_reloc_reg() 184 uint32_t assign_type = assign_p->pci_phys_hi & PCI_REG_ADDR_M; in pci_reloc_reg() 185 uint32_t assign_addr = PCI_REG_BDFR_G(assign_p->pci_phys_hi); in pci_reloc_reg() 190 rp->pci_phys_low += assign_p->pci_phys_low; in pci_reloc_reg() 195 rp->pci_phys_low += assign_p->pci_phys_low; in pci_reloc_reg() 200 kmem_free(assign_p - i, assign_len); in pci_reloc_reg()
|
/illumos-gate/usr/src/uts/sun4u/opl/io/pcicmu/ |
H A D | pcmu_util.c | 143 pci_regspec_t *assign_p; in pcmu_reloc_reg() local 165 "assigned-addresses", (caddr_t)&assign_p, &assign_len)) { in pcmu_reloc_reg() 170 for (i = 0; i < assign_entries; i++, assign_p++) { in pcmu_reloc_reg() 171 if ((assign_p->pci_phys_hi & mask) == phys_addr) { in pcmu_reloc_reg() 172 rp->pci_phys_low += assign_p->pci_phys_low; in pcmu_reloc_reg() 176 kmem_free(assign_p - i, assign_len); in pcmu_reloc_reg()
|
/illumos-gate/usr/src/cmd/fm/modules/common/fabric-xlate/ |
H A D | fx_subr.c | 638 pci_regspec_t *assign_p; in fab_find_addr() local 681 for (assign_p = (pci_regspec_t *)prop; in fab_find_addr() 682 assign_p->pci_phys_hi != (uint_t)-1; assign_p++) { in fab_find_addr() 683 low = assign_p->pci_phys_low; in fab_find_addr() 684 hi = low + assign_p->pci_size_low; in fab_find_addr()
|
/illumos-gate/usr/src/uts/common/io/pciex/ |
H A D | pcie_fault.c | 459 pci_regspec_t *assign_p = bus_p->bus_assigned_addr; in pf_in_assigned_addr() local 461 for (i = 0; i < bus_p->bus_assigned_entries; i++, assign_p++) { in pf_in_assigned_addr() 462 low = assign_p->pci_phys_low; in pf_in_assigned_addr() 463 hi = low + assign_p->pci_size_low; in pf_in_assigned_addr()
|